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69588551344 5781239 075723895 4488405 10650
34657629737 242
34657629737 242
929597486 518447 211517199
All about undefined
Interested in learning more?
34657629737 242
929597486 518447 211517199
See more
5642 0684625 47
01 81956598 014304
See more
66 61 6694515042
983 68299 38
See more